F8 和开源播客中的 React Native
·3 分钟阅读
本周,Eli White 在 F8 2019 上发表了关于 Facebook Android 和 iOS 应用程序中 React Native 的演讲。我们很高兴能分享我们过去两年来的工作和接下来的计划。
在 Facebook 开发者网站上查看视频

演讲重点:
- 我们在 2017 年和 2018 年专注于 React Native 的最大产品——Facebook 的 Marketplace。我们与 Marketplace 团队合作,提高了产品的质量并增加了用户体验的乐趣。目前,Marketplace 是 Facebook 应用程序中 Android 和 iOS 上质量最高的产品之一。
- Marketplace 的性能也是一个巨大的挑战,尤其是在中端 Android 设备上。去年,我们将启动时间缩短了 50% 以上,并且还有更多改进正在进行中!最大的改进正在内置到 React Native 中,并将于今年晚些时候向社区推出。
- 我们有信心使用 React Native 构建 Facebook 所需的高质量和高性能应用程序。这种信心让我们能够进行更大的投资,例如重新思考 React Native 的核心。
- 微软支持并使用 React Native for Windows,使人们能够利用他们的专业知识和代码库来渲染到微软的通用 Windows 平台。下周查看 Microsoft Build,听他们详细介绍。
关于开源的 React Radio 播客
Eli 的演讲最后谈到了我们最近的开源工作。我们在3 月份更新了我们的进展,最近 Nader Dabit 和 Gant Laborde 邀请 Christoph 参加他们的播客 React Native Radio,聊聊 React Native 的开源情况。
播客重点:
- 我们讨论了 Facebook 的 React Native 团队如何看待开源,以及我们如何构建一个可持续发展的社区,使其能够适应 React Native 规模的项目。
- 我们正在按计划删除多个模块,作为 Lean Core 工作的一部分。许多模块,如 WebView 和 React Native CLI,在它们被提取后收到了超过 100 个拉取请求。
- 接下来,我们将专注于彻底改造 React Native 网站和文档。敬请期待!
您很快就能在您喜欢的播客应用程序中找到该集,或者您可以在此处收听录音